WebThe privilege is not the same as a California citizen’s arrest. A citizen’s arrest is an arrest made by a citizen who has no official arrest authority because he is not a law enforcement officer, police department, or a governmental agent. 19. Penal Code 837 PC is the California statute that authorizes a citizen’s arrest in certain ... Peace Officers CA Codes (pen:830-832.17) PENAL CODE SECTION 830-832.17 black false teethWebSep 1, 2024 · In February 2024, for example, a security guard protecting a synagogue in Los Angeles shot a First Amendment auditor standing on the public sidewalk after she refused to stop filming and depart the area. The guard was arrested on suspicion of assault with a deadly weapon, but charges were not filed by Los Angeles prosecutors. game heads up seven up
